Con`chy*la"ceous, Con*chyl`i*a"ceous, a. Etym: [L. conchylium shell, Gr. Conch.]
Definition: Of or pertaining to shells; resembling a shell; as, conchyliaceous impressions. Kirwan.
Source: Webster’s Unabridged Dictionary 1913 Edition
